What is the lug width of the Grand Seiko Spring Drive SBGA227?
The SBGA227 features a lug width of 20mm. This specification is crucial for purchasing a compatible strap: the distance between the two internal attachment points must correspond precisely to 20mm. Incorrect measurement would result in unwanted play or mounting impossibility. Standardisation at 20mm enables the use of any strap manufactured for this lug size, ensuring universal compatibility with the SBGA227 case.

How do you change the strap on a Grand Seiko SBGA227?
Changing the SBGA227 strap requires specific tools: a springbar tool (lever screwdriver for spring-bar lugs) or a multi-tool. Position the watch on a stable surface, protect the case with a soft cloth, locate the tiny spring bars hidden in the lateral case holes. Insert the tool lever beneath the bar and gently lift to decompress the spring, then extract the old strap. Repeat on the opposite side. For installing the new strap, align the holes with the lugs and press gently until a click indicates locking. If you lack confidence, consulting a professional watchmaker remains the safest choice to avoid case scratching.

What is the lifespan of a leather strap for the Grand Seiko SBGA227?
The lifespan of a leather strap depends on usage frequency, environmental exposure (humidity, extreme temperatures, UV rays) and material composition. A high-quality alligator or shell cordovan strap with vegetable tanning can last 3–5 years of daily use before showing structural failure signs; aesthetic ageing begins earlier, with gradual patina development and colour shifts. Calf leather straps present a slightly shorter lifecycle, 2–3 years, due to lower fibre density. Regular maintenance—cleaning with a damp cloth and natural air-drying, occasional leather conditioner applications—substantially extends longevity.
